Notes:
    a.    Performance standards shall be applied to and achieved in each separate plant community zone and do not apply to designated open water areas.
    b.    Upon final acceptance, it is the expectation that the PCBMP will continue to be maintained as specified in the stormwater management certification in perpetuity or until modified by a subsequent stormwater management certification.
    c.    BMP standards are only for BMPs with a tributary area greater than 1 acre. There are no performance standards for BMPs with tributary areas of less than 1 acre.
    d.    As measured by aerial coverage, excluding the emergent zone. The emergent zone must achieve a minimum of 50 percent vegetative cover.
    e.    Species include, but are not limited to: Typha angustifolia, Typha X glauca, Phragmites australis, Lythrum salicaria, Salix interior, Phalaris arundinacea, Cirsium arvense, Melilotus sp., Poa pratensis, Dipasacus sp.
    f.    FQI and/or () can be adjusted downward when taking the context of the location into consideration. PCBMPs are not required to meet FQI or ().
    g.    Percentage can be adjusted downward based on quantities planted and when taking the context of the location into consideration.
(Ord. G-976, 7-24-2012)
